Frequently Asked Questions

What Accessories Are Essential For Protecting And Using A Digital Camera Effectively While Scuba Diving?

Essential accessories for protecting and using a digital camera effectively while scuba diving include a waterproof housing to ensure the camera remains dry and intact, and a desiccant to prevent lens fogging. Additionally, a red filter can enhance color correction at depth, and a wrist or hand strap ensures the camera remains securely attached to the diver.

What Should Beginners Look For In A Digital Camera For Scuba Diving?

Beginners should look for a digital camera that is waterproof and offers easy-to-use controls, with features like image stabilization, good low-light performance, and a wide-angle lens to effectively capture underwater scenes. Additionally, it’s beneficial to have a camera with a durable, rugged design and decent battery life to withstand underwater conditions.

How Do The Features Of Underwater Digital Cameras Enhance Scuba Diving Photography?

Underwater digital cameras enhance scuba diving photography by offering water-resistant housing and specialized lenses that compensate for light distortion and color loss at depth. They often include features like built-in white balance adjustments and high ISO settings to capture clear, vibrant images in low-light underwater environments.
